  1. St Joseph’s University is a Jesuit university at the heart of Bengaluru, the silicon city of India. Established in 1882 by Paris Foreign Mission Fathers, the management of the college was handed over to the Jesuit order (Society of Jesus) in 1937.

  2. St Joseph’s College Bangalore, Karnataka, is an autonomous higher education institution established in 1882 with the view to provide education to the minority Catholic community of the area. It is affiliated to the Bangalore University. The college was granted College for Excellence‘ (CE) status by the UGC and accredited as A++ by NAAC.

  4. Saint Joseph’s University spans two locations in and around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. The 125-acre Hawk Hill campus and 24-acre University City location offer students the best of both worlds: a historic Main Line suburb and a vibrant Philadelphia neighborhood just west of Center City.

  5. Saint Joseph's University's main campus, often referred to as Hawk Hill, is located on City Avenue, which splits the university between the western edge of Philadelphia and Lower Merion Township. Portions of the property are in the Lower Merion side.
